ANNISTON, AL — Anniston Museums and Gardens will host its monthly Berman Book Club on Tuesday, May 5 at 6 p.m. at its Museum Drive location in Anniston.
The program invites participants to explore historical fiction through guided discussion and curated artifacts from the Berman collection that relate to each month’s selected book. Organizers say the goal of the series is to provide additional historical context and encourage conversation around the themes and events presented in the literature.
The featured selection for May is Cloud of Sparrows by Takashi Matsuoka, a novel set in 19th-century Japan that blends historical events with fictional storytelling.
According to event details, pre-registration is encouraged. Admission is listed at $8 per person, with a discounted rate available for members.
The event is open to the public, including those who do not use Facebook, and will take place at the Anniston Museums and Gardens campus on Museum Drive.
